Popular Airports for Private Jets in Nashville

  1. Nashville International Airport (BNA) – Ideal for those who want proximity to downtown and major hotels.

  2. John C. Tune Airport (JWN) – A top choice for business travelers and celebrities due to its private jet-centric facilities.

  3. Smyrna Airport (MQY) – Offers longer runways and quieter traffic, perfect for larger aircraft.

Available Aircraft Categories

At NPJ, we provide access to every jet category to meet your exact mission. Here’s a breakdown of the most requested options:

Light Jets (e.g., Citation CJ3, Learjet 40)

  • Seats: 6–7

  • Range: ~1,500 miles

  • Great for short hops like Nashville to Miami, Chicago, or NYC.

Super Light Jets (e.g., Phenom 300, Lear 75)

  • Seats: 7–8

  • Range: ~2,000 miles

  • Ideal for trips with small groups and slightly longer distance.

Midsize Jets (e.g., Hawker 800XP, Citation XLS+)

  • Seats: 7–9

  • Range: ~2,200–2,500 miles

  • Comfortable cabins for longer domestic flights.

Super Midsize Jets (e.g., Challenger 350, Citation Sovereign)

  • Seats: 8–10

  • Range: ~3,000+ miles

  • Popular for coast-to-coast or international flights to the Caribbean.

Heavy Jets (e.g., Gulfstream G-IV, Challenger 604)

  • Seats: 10–14

  • Range: ~4,000+ miles

  • Spacious cabins with full galleys and stand-up lavatories.

Ultra Long-Range Jets (e.g., Gulfstream G650, Global 7500)

  • Seats: 12–19

  • Range: 6,000–7,700 miles

  • Nonstop Nashville to Tokyo, London, or Dubai with luxury suites.

VIP Airliners (e.g., BBJ, ACJ)

  • Seats: 16–50+

  • For heads of state, band tours, sports teams, and ultra-high net worth groups.

How Pricing Works

Private jet pricing depends on:

  • Aircraft type

  • Flight hours

  • Airport fees

  • Fuel surcharges

  • Positioning fees

  • Federal Excise Tax (FET)

Sample One-Way Prices from Nashville:

  • Nashville to Miami (Light Jet): $11,000–$15,000

  • Nashville to Los Angeles (Super Midsize): $35,000–$45,000

  • Nashville to London (Heavy Jet): $85,000–$120,000
